I decided to use my new Home Brew Combo stamp and die set by Waffle Flower Crafts to create my card. I was originally making this for my nephew but remembered as I was finished that I he does not drink beer!!! However, I have a ton of people I can send my card to.


I colored in the beer glasses with Copic Markers and did some ink blending with Distress Inks on the beer bottle (Mowed Lawn) and the icon (Mustard Seed and Wild Honey).


I also flicked some Walnut Stain in the background but the icon covered up most of it.


I die cut the stars from silver mirrored cardstock using the Fun-Fetti Fri-dies from CAS-ual Fridays Stamps.

I stenciled the background using an Echo Park stencil and some pink and red dye ink. The letter is from Waffle Flower Crafts "Mailbox Die" and was die cut from a red cardstock scrap.


The penguin is Simon Says Stamp's "Picture Book Hugging Penguin" and the sentiment is from their "Love and Valentine's Word Mix 2."
